6
1919-1975 Technology Dr
Troy, MI 48083
$12.95 USD/SF/YR
5,291-40,288 SF
3
Spaces Available
Built 1985
40,288 SF Contiguous
Built 1985
5,291-40,288 SF
$12.95 USD/SF/YR
Flex, Industrial